**Handover — Pipewright canary gating**

Hi Maren, passing this to you for review before I'm out. The canary gate for Pipewright now blocks promotion if error rate or p95 latency breaches threshold during the bake window, and I added a minimum-traffic floor so quiet hours don't auto-pass. The tricky part is the rollback debounce — review that logic closely, as it interacts with the bake timer. Everything is driven from one config map, and the values I deployed to staging are below.

deployment values, yadup-kadug:
[sorys]
port = 5672
team = noveth
host = sorys.orvexcorp.example
region = south-4
access_code = ac_deddc1
timeout_ms = 1500

## Onboarding: Fan-out Backpressure

Notifier fan-out at Quillbrook is pull-based. Workers drain `notif_outbox` in batches of 500; when downstream latency exceeds 2s p95, the dispatcher halves batch size and pauses new enqueues. Never raise batch size manually — the controller owns it. Backpressure state lives in the `fanout_control` table, one row per channel. If a channel is wedged, check its row before touching anything else. To inspect control state in staging, use the connection string below.

primary connection of yagep-kahip = redis://giliel_svc:zYiKsLL2PLpfPL@db-348f.xolmarsys.corp:5432/fenwyn

**Mgmt Meeting Minutes — Retiring the Brightline Range**

Quick recap for sales leads at Fenholt Supplies: we agreed to retire the Brightline fixture range by year-end. Remaining stock moves to clearance pricing next month, and accounts on standing orders get migrated to the Lumetta range. Trade-in incentives were approved in principle. The confidential note on next steps sits just below.

board note of bajof-bajeg: The pricing group signed off on a budget of $13.4 million for Project Sildor. The renewal with Lamixek Holdings closes at $48.9 million a year, 49 percent above the last contract.

# Env Vars: Planner Regression Mitigation

After the query planner regression in Corvid DB 9.3, Fernwell's release builds must pin the legacy planner until the patched build ships. Set `CORVID_PLANNER_MODE=legacy` in the release env file and confirm it with the preflight check before tagging. The planner override endpoint requires authentication, so the release env file also needs the planner override token on the next line.

env line for kahof-fajeg: ARCHIVE_KEY3=397